Output dd4d51811c72a4e854ed9445e1cc606e3b159c967c8f946838f07c8a442e7ab7:69

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76c12717cfb03a6af9655b65cac14606693f648880bd115a1da215a781fee39e
address
bc1pwmqjw970kqax47t9tdju4s2xqe5n7eygsz73zksa5g260q07uw0q4jdxj9
transaction
dd4d51811c72a4e854ed9445e1cc606e3b159c967c8f946838f07c8a442e7ab7
spent
true